Output d89fe81aadea5938350fec6a5ba6b603925ff879cb84bf3fb81b43fcaad048fc:0

value
1861449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ed1a4abcf2c46064eac12e464a99581bfea0813 OP_EQUAL
address
3ALNaquJchK3dWnWYtGD62YLMnnAfMyK8y
transaction
d89fe81aadea5938350fec6a5ba6b603925ff879cb84bf3fb81b43fcaad048fc
spent
true